Transaction eac68117a366b0ab922e46662a0022c1b75e3cf840d3e5d8e45368571d254eb8
1 Input
1 Output
-
eac68117a366b0ab922e46662a0022c1b75e3cf840d3e5d8e45368571d254eb8:0
- value
- 25594
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f0186da99cfa8f5949c85f960965826b3cc6c560 OP_EQUAL
- address
- 3PaXMtv6u2wL1HJPqACn5fQqbJzzf1ASvP